WebNov 22, 2024 · EGD is a form of endoscopy in which a fiber-optic scope equipped with a camera can look inside the body without the need for an incision. For an EGD, the endoscope is inserted through the mouth and throat, usually under mild sedation. WebSep 24, 2024 · As with any procedure, there are some complications associated with Halo ablation. Overall, however, it has proven to be a safe treatment for Barrett’s esophagus. 1-2% of patients report more severe post-procedure pain which lasts longer than a few days.
